ALEXANDRIA, Va., Nov. 6 -- United States Patent no. 12,460,239, issued on Nov. 4, was assigned to Corn Products Development Inc. (Westchester, Ill.).
"UDP-glycosyltransferase variants and uses thereof" was invented by Sean Lund (Emeryville, Calif.) and Gale Wichmann (Emeryville, Calif.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Provided herein are genetically modified host cells, compositions, and methods for improved production of steviol glycosides. The host cells are genetically modified to contain a heterologous nucleic acid that expresses novel and optimized variants of UGT76G1.
